Genisys  Genisys API 1.9.3
A server software for Minecraft: Pocket Edition with many features
Particle Class Reference
Inheritance diagram for Particle:
[legend]
Collaboration diagram for Particle:
[legend]

Public Member Functions

 encode ()
 
- Public Member Functions inherited from Vector3
 __construct ($x=0, $y=0, $z=0)
 
 getX ()
 
 getY ()
 
 getZ ()
 
 getFloorX ()
 
 getFloorY ()
 
 getFloorZ ()
 
 getRight ()
 
 getUp ()
 
 getForward ()
 
 getSouth ()
 
 getWest ()
 
 add ($x, $y=0, $z=0)
 
 subtract ($x=0, $y=0, $z=0)
 
 multiply ($number)
 
 divide ($number)
 
 ceil ()
 
 floor ()
 
 round ()
 
 abs ()
 
 getSide ($side, $step=1)
 
 distance (Vector3 $pos)
 
 distanceSquared (Vector3 $pos)
 
 maxPlainDistance ($x=0, $z=0)
 
 length ()
 
 lengthSquared ()
 
 normalize ()
 
 dot (Vector3 $v)
 
 cross (Vector3 $v)
 
 equals (Vector3 $v)
 
 getIntermediateWithXValue (Vector3 $v, $x)
 
 getIntermediateWithYValue (Vector3 $v, $y)
 
 getIntermediateWithZValue (Vector3 $v, $z)
 
 setComponents ($x, $y, $z)
 
 fromObjectAdd (Vector3 $pos, $x, $y, $z)
 
 __toString ()
 

Data Fields

const TYPE_BUBBLE = 1
 
const TYPE_CRITICAL = 2
 
const TYPE_BLOCK_FORCE_FIELD = 3
 
const TYPE_SMOKE = 4
 
const TYPE_EXPLODE = 5
 
const TYPE_EVAPORATION = 6
 
const TYPE_FLAME = 7
 
const TYPE_LAVA = 8
 
const TYPE_LARGE_SMOKE = 9
 
const TYPE_REDSTONE = 10
 
const TYPE_RISING_RED_DUST = 11
 
const TYPE_ITEM_BREAK = 12
 
const TYPE_SNOWBALL_POOF = 13
 
const TYPE_HUGE_EXPLODE = 14
 
const TYPE_HUGE_EXPLODE_SEED = 15
 
const TYPE_MOB_FLAME = 16
 
const TYPE_HEART = 17
 
const TYPE_TERRAIN = 18
 
const TYPE_SUSPENDED_TOWN = 19
 
const TYPE_TOWN_AURA = 19
 
const TYPE_PORTAL = 20
 
const TYPE_SPLASH = 21
 
const TYPE_WATER_SPLASH = 21
 
const TYPE_WATER_WAKE = 22
 
const TYPE_DRIP_WATER = 23
 
const TYPE_DRIP_LAVA = 24
 
const TYPE_FALLING_DUST = 25
 
const TYPE_DUST = 25
 
const TYPE_MOB_SPELL = 26
 
const TYPE_MOB_SPELL_AMBIENT = 27
 
const TYPE_MOB_SPELL_INSTANTANEOUS = 28
 
const TYPE_INK = 29
 
const TYPE_SLIME = 30
 
const TYPE_RAIN_SPLASH = 31
 
const TYPE_VILLAGER_ANGRY = 32
 
const TYPE_VILLAGER_HAPPY = 33
 
const TYPE_ENCHANTMENT_TABLE = 34
 
const TYPE_TRACKING_EMITTER = 35
 
const TYPE_NOTE = 36
 
const TYPE_WITCH_SPELL = 37
 
const TYPE_CARROT = 38
 
const TYPE_END_ROD = 40
 
const TYPE_DRAGONS_BREATH = 41
 
- Data Fields inherited from Vector3
const SIDE_DOWN = 0
 
const SIDE_UP = 1
 
const SIDE_NORTH = 2
 
const SIDE_SOUTH = 3
 
const SIDE_WEST = 4
 
const SIDE_EAST = 5
 
 $x
 
 $y
 
 $z
 

Additional Inherited Members

- Static Public Member Functions inherited from Vector3
static getOppositeSide (int $side)
 
static createRandomDirection (Random $random)
 

Member Function Documentation

encode ( )
abstract
Returns
DataPacket|DataPacket[]

The documentation for this class was generated from the following file: